Desktop QuickBooks for Your Business Workshop
This powerful accounting system for small businesses will enable you to track the progress of your company and at the same time allow you to focus on your business, not on being an accountant. QuickBooks is a tool you can use to automate the tasks you will need to perform as a business owner to document and track the accounting activity of your existing business, or to set up a new business. This course will provide an opportunity for hands-on practice. It is designed for PC users only. Topics include: Setting up QuickBooks, working with lists and accounts, entering sales information, receiving payments and making deposits, entering and paying bills, analyzing financial data, setting up inventory, tracking and paying sales tax, doing payroll with QuickBooks, estimating and progress invoicing, tracking time and customizing forms and writing QuickBooks letters.
